/* CSS Document */

body {

	margin-left: 0px;

	margin-top: 0px;

	margin-right: 0px;

	margin-bottom: 0px;

	background-color: #FFFFFF;

	background-image: url(../imagens/bg1b.jpg);

}

body,td,th {

	font-family: "Trebuchet MS";

	font-size: 12px;

	color: #333333;

}

.oqueteremos {

	font-family: "Trebuchet MS";

	font-size: 13px;

	color: #666666;

	text-decoration: none;

}

.atender {



	font-family: "Trebuchet MS";

	font-size: 16px;

	color: #BF9F62;

	text-decoration: none;

}

.divmargens {

	margin-right: 35px;

	margin-left: 35px;

	margin-bottom: 20px;

}

.titulo {

	background-image: url(../imagens/sombrancelha.jpg);

	background-repeat: no-repeat;

	background-position: center top;

}

.divtitlebox {

	font-family: verdana,arial,default;

	font-size: 12px;

	font-weight: bold;

	color: #990000;

	text-decoration: none;

	padding-left: 45 px;

	margin-top: 15px;

	margin-bottom: 10px;

}

.divtitlemateria {

	padding-left: 20px;

	margin-bottom: 5px;

	padding-right: 10px;

}

.divtitlenoticia {

	font-family: "trebuchet MS";

	font-size: 13px;

	font-weight: bold;

	color: #CC0000;

	text-decoration: none;

	margin-bottom: 2px;

}

.divbloquer {

	margin-bottom: 8px;

}

.mydate {

	font-family: "trebuchet MS";

	font-size: 12px;

	font-style: italic;

	color: #999999;

	text-decoration: none;

}

.textocomum {

	font-family: "trebuchet MS";

	font-size: 11px;

	color: #333333;

	text-decoration: none;

}

a:hover {

	text-decoration: underline;

}

.divtextofrota {

	font-weight: bold;

	text-decoration: none;

	margin-bottom: 10px;

}

.divmargensinferior {

	padding-left: 15px;

}

.FundoRodape {

	background-image: url(../imagens/fundo_inferior.jpg);

	background-repeat: repeat-x;

	background-position: bottom;

}

.Fundo_Aba {

	background-image: url(../imagens/fundo_azul_aba.gif);

	background-repeat: no-repeat;

	background-position: right bottom;

}

.dataMateria {

	font-family: "trebuchet MS";

	font-size: 12px;

	font-style: italic;

	color: #999999;

	text-decoration: none;

}

.Endereco {

	font-family: "trebuchet MS";

	font-size: 11px;
	align:right;
	color: #FFFFFF;
	text-decoration: none;
	margin-left: 35px; 
	margin-right: 50px; 
	
	
}

.margenFrota {

	margin-top: 5px;

	margin-bottom: 5px;

	margin-right: 15px;

	margin-left: 25px;

}

.divIntinerario {



	padding-left: 60px;

	margin-bottom: 10px;

	padding-right: 10px;

}

.RodapeEnd {

	margin-bottom: 5px;

}

.fundoSuperSobrancelha {



	background-image: url(../imagens/divisa_hor_extra.jpg);

	background-repeat: no-repeat;

	background-position: center top;

}

.divtitleboxNoticias {

	font-family: "trebuchet MS";

	font-size: 16px;

	font-weight: bold;

	color: #007CC2;

	text-decoration: none;

	margin-top: 23px;

	margin-bottom: 7px;

	margin-left: 60px;

}

.titlePagina {

	font-family: "trebuchet MS";

	font-size: 18px;

	font-weight: bold;

	color: #990000;

	text-decoration: underline ;

	margin-bottom: 20px;

}

.divtitleboxRodape {

	margin-left: 20px;

}

.marginBottom {

	margin-right: 10px;

}

.divBoxListaNoticias {

	margin-left: 35px;

}

.BordaListaNoticias {

	margin-right: 15px;

	border-right-width: 25px;

	border-top-style: none;

	border-right-style: solid;

	border-bottom-style: none;

	border-left-style: none;

	border-right-color: #FFFFFF;

}

.formselect {

	font-family: "trebuchet MS";

	font-size: 12px;

	color: #666666;

	text-decoration: none;

	background-color: #F5F5FC;

	border: 1px solid #0066CC;

}

.forminput {

	font-family: "trebuchet MS";

	font-size: 12px;

	color: #666666;

	text-decoration: none;

	background-color: #F5F5FC;

	border: 1px solid #0066CC;

}

.back {



	margin-left: 0px;

	margin-top: 0px;

	margin-right: 0px;

	margin-bottom: 0px;
	background-image: url(../imagens/fundo.jpg);

	background-repeat: repeat-y;

	background-position: center;

}

.title_curriculo_etapa {

	font-family: "trebuchet MS";

	font-size: 14px;

	font-weight: bold;

	color: #333333;

	text-decoration: none;

}

.divtitleboxultimo {


	font-family: "trebuchet MS";

	font-size: 16px;

	font-weight: bold;

	color: #007CC2;

	text-decoration: none;

	padding-left: 75px;

	margin-top: 15px;

	margin-bottom: 10px;
}
.fundosobrancelhaultimo {


	background-image: url(../imagens/sombrancelha.jpg);

	background-repeat: no-repeat;

	background-position: 30px top;
}

#titulo {
	margin-top:10px;
	background-repeat: no-repeat;
	background-position:Left;
	heigth:20px;
	border-left:4px solid #CCCCCC;
	padding-left:3px;
	font-size:18px;
	font-weight: bold;
	color: #333333;
}

.corpoo {
 border : 1px solid #CCCCCC;
 margin-top:10px;
 margin-bottom:10px;
 padding-top:0px;
 padding-bottom:2px;
}
.topo_horarios {
	background : #EBEBEB;
	font-size:11px;
	font-weight: bold;
	
}
.linha_horarios{
	border-bottom:1px solid #EBEBEB;
	text-align:left;
}
.tablehorarios{
	border-left:1px solid #EBEBEB;
	border-right:1px solid #EBEBEB;
}
input,select{
margin-left :30px;
margin-top:2px;
border :1px solid #CCCCCC;
font-size:12px;
width:200px;
color : #990000;
}
.inputestado{
margin-left :5px;
margin-top:2px;
border :1px solid #CCCCCC;
font-size:12px;
width:30px;
color : #990000;
}
textarea{
margin-left :30px;
margin-top:2px;
border :1px solid #CCCCCC;
font-size:12px;
width:200px;
height:100px;
color : #990000;
};
submit{
border:1px solid #990000;
width:60px;
background:#FFFFFF
}
.lala{
	background-image: url(../imagens/onibbg.jpg);
	background-repeat: no-repeat;
	background-position:left bottom;
}

.tabeladomeio {
	background-image:url(../imagens/frentemeio.jpg);
	background-repeat: no-repeat;
	background-position:top;
	
}
.voltar{
	margin-left: 35px;
	margin-bottom: 5px;
}